Did you know that even the ancient Romans used concrete in their construction? They valued it for its strength and for its ability to be molded into different forms. They formed concrete from volcanic ash and lime, which were a bit different from the materials used today, but the substance was very similar and used for similar purposes. Today, concrete contractors carry on the ancient Roman tradition, making everything from patios to counter tops from concrete. These creations last for years and require little maintenance.     If you're planning to add a small concrete structure to your backyard, then you have a decision to make. Whether you're building a patio, a retaining wall, or some other feature, you need to decide whether you're going to have the concrete poured in place or if you're going to opt for precast concrete. Precast is concrete that is formed by pouring it into a reusable mold in an off-site location.
